What I’m Playing
What have I been playing lately? Most of my time has been spent playing World of Warcraft. Devee, my troll priest is now 39, and I’ve been PVPing a lot. I bought every item that I need for my level as well as a couple level 40 pieces. As soon as I get bored of PVPing, I’ll go back to PVE, but for now I’m enjoying it!
The other game I’ve been playing heavily is Overlord, which is very fun. It’s an action adventure game with some RPG elements for Xbox 360 in which you’re an evil overlord and must kill the heroes who killed your predecessor. You have an alignment that can go from evil to eviler, and you control many minions to kill enemies. Very fun.
